Teenager Rescues Longhorn Calf from Frozen Pond

Teenager Oliver Reyes risks his own safety to rescue a calf named Wynonna from a frozen pond, showcasing the power of compassion.

A brave teenager named Oliver Reyes recently became famous for rescuing a calf that had fallen into a frozen pond. This happened at his family's farm in Philadelphia, Tennessee. Oliver saw that a two-month-old cow named Wynonna was stuck in the ice and immediately decided to help. In an interview with the BBC, the 16-year-old said that he didn't even think about it, he just acted on instinct.

Oliver's heroic act was caught on video and quickly became popular on social media. The video shows him running out of a car and jumping into the freezing water to save the calf. Even though it was dangerous, Oliver managed to reach Wynonna and bring her to safety. His quick thinking and bravery saved the young cow's life.

This heartwarming story reminds us how important it is to be kind and brave. Oliver's actions show us how powerful our instincts can be and how we should be ready to help others, even if it means taking risks. His selfless act has inspired many people and shows us what it means to be brave.

The video of Oliver's rescue has received a lot of praise and admiration. It shows us how strong the bond between humans and animals can be and how far some people will go to protect and care for them. Oliver's bravery not only saved a life but also touched the hearts of people all over the world.

In conclusion, Oliver Reyes's courageous act of jumping into a frozen pond to save a calf has caught the attention and admiration of people everywhere. His quick response to the situation and his willingness to put himself in danger to save another life is truly inspiring. This story reminds us of the power of kindness and bravery and how one person's actions can make a big difference.

Group or Classroom Activities

Warm-up Activities:

– News Summary
Instructions: In pairs, students will take turns summarizing the article to their partner. They should include the main points and key details. After each summary, the listener can ask follow-up questions for clarification. Switch roles and repeat with a different partner.
– Opinion Poll
Instructions: In small groups, students will discuss their opinions on Oliver's actions. They should consider questions such as: "Do you think Oliver's act was brave?" "Would you have done the same thing in his situation?" "What risks would you be willing to take to help someone?" Each student should share their opinions and provide reasons to support their views.
– Vocabulary Pictionary
Instructions: Students will work in pairs or small groups. Each group will have a list of vocabulary words from the article. One student will choose a word and draw a picture to represent it, while the rest of the group tries to guess the word. The student who guesses correctly will then draw the next word. This activity will help reinforce vocabulary from the article.
– Pros and Cons
Instructions: In pairs, students will discuss the pros and cons of Oliver's actions. They should consider questions such as: "What are the benefits of his bravery?" "What are the risks involved in his rescue?" "Were there any negative consequences of his actions?" Each student should present their ideas and provide evidence to support their arguments.
– Future Predictions
Instructions: In small groups, students will discuss and make predictions about the future impact of Oliver's story. They should consider questions such as: "How do you think this experience will affect Oliver's life?" "Will this story inspire others to act bravely?" "Do you think Oliver will continue to help animals in the future?" Each student should share their predictions and provide reasons to support their ideas.
